Roses hold a spiritual significance throughout history. Monks took care of rose gardens in the Middle Ages. Biblical scholars cite references to roses in the Bible. A single red rose, as the Alchemy Guild points out, symbolizes the mystic center.

A single white is called the rose of confession.


Believers anoint themselves with rose oil before praying.

The rose is a symbol of the soul in the Muslim religion. Prophet Muhammad used roses as part of his spiritual practices. The fragrance of the rose reminds followers of the connection with their souls.


Jesus wore a crown of thorns which symbolizes sacrifice.

Roses appear in religious depictions of paradise. As the Rev. Theodore A. Koehler notes, the red rose stands for martyrs. The five petals of the rose signify the wounds of Christ. The Virgin Mary is the "Mystic Rose."


The color of a rose has spiritual significance. The white rose, the "rose of confession" stands for pure spiritual love. White roses in a bridal bouquet represent a holy union. Red roses stand for sacrifice.


Giving a single white rose expresses forgiveness. A bouquet of a dozen roses means "true love" because 12 is considered by many religions as a complete cycle. Nine roses stand for eternal love.


Aphrodite is depicted with roses in her hair. Achilles's shield has a rose emblem. The Greek poet Sappho wrote about roses.